A thrilling visual novel adventure follows a special agent solving a bizarre UFO abduction case through dream-diving, puzzles, and escape rooms in Tokyo.
No Sleep For Kaname Date - From AI: The Somnium Files is a captivating addition to Spike Chunsoft's acclaimed visual novel adventure series, blending sci-fi mystery with psychological depth. Set in a near-futuristic Tokyo, the game follows Special Agent Kaname Date, a Psyncer with the Advanced Brain Investigation Squad (ABIS), as he tackles a bizarre case. Primal Planet is a captivating indie Metroidvania that blends survival mechanics with heartfelt storytelling, all set in a vibrant world filled with dinosaurs.
Primal Planet marks a powerful debut from solo developer Seethingswarm, offering a fresh twist on the Metroidvania formula. Set in a vivid, hand-crafted alien world filled with dinosaurs, the game blends pixel-art exploration with survival mechanics and heartfelt storytelling, entirely without dialogue. Instead of speaking, characters emote and interact through expressive animation, weaving a surprisingly emotional tale of family, danger, and resilience.

Become tiny once more to dive into the biggest adventure of your life in Grounded 2.
Fans of the backyard survival genre have plenty to celebrate as Obsidian Entertainment, in collaboration with Eidos-Montréal, prepares to launch Grounded 2 into Early Access on July 29, 2025. The sequel to the critically acclaimed Grounded will be available for Xbox Series X|S, PC (Steam and Xbox app), and Xbox Cloud Gaming, with day-one access included for Xbox Game Pass Ultimate and PC Game Pass subscribers.

While details remain sparse, the listing describes Project Hadar as a completely new IP still in early development.
CD Projekt Red has revealed new clues about its mysterious project, codenamed Hadar, through a recent job listing. The studio is seeking a Senior Gameplay Designer with experience in melee-oriented RPG/action games, hinting that Project Hadar may lean heavily into close-quarters combat—possibly offering something quite different from the gunplay-focused Cyberpunk 2077.

Despite performance and storage concerns, there’s still plenty of good news for Switch 2 players.
As excitement builds for the upcoming Borderlands 4, fans on Nintendo’s next-gen handheld hybrid, the Switch 2, now have more clarity on what to expect performance-wise. According to Gearbox Software’s Randy Pitchford, the game will run “mostly around 30 FPS,” with occasional dips during intense combat or multiplayer sessions—particularly in handheld mode.

Set against the rich tapestry of feudal Japan, Assassin's Creed Shadows plunges players into a world of political intrigue and betrayal.
Assassin's Creed Shadows, Ubisoft’s latest major installment in its iconic franchise, appears to be preparing for a launch on the much-anticipated Nintendo Switch 2. Although no official confirmation has been issued yet, several strong indicators suggest that a version for Nintendo’s upcoming hardware is in the works.
